How they compare

Malawi currently reports 8,221 t against 7,873 t in Burkina Faso, a difference of 348 t.

The two have swapped places 6 times across 19 shared years of data; in 2002 it was Malawi ahead.

Burkina Faso ranks 77th and Malawi ranks 76th of 169 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Burkina Faso averaged higher in 1 and Malawi in 2.

The Fertilizers by Product dataset contains information on the Production, Trade and Agriculture Use of inorganic (chemical or mineral) fertilizers products. The fertilizer statistics data are for a set of 23 product categories. Both straight and compound fertilizers are included.
